Health Canada Proposes Lower E-Liquid Nicotine Strength Limit

In Canada, vapers are limited to e-liquids containing no more than 66mg/ml of nicotine. This national limitation on e-liquid nicotine strength could change in 2021, as Health Canada has proposed lowering the limit to 20mg/ml. Australia Postpones Nicotine Vape Ban

Earlier this month, Australia’s Minister of Health, Greg Hunt, proposed a federal ban on the importation of nicotine e-liquid into Australia. Just days before the ban was scheduled to go into effect, Minister Hunt changed course and indicated that the proposed ban would be delayed for six months. Nicotine E-Liquid Ban Proposed By Australian Government

In Australia, state laws across the country currently prohibit the sale of nicotine e-liquid. However, this hasn’t stopped the country’s vapers from buying e-liquids that contain nicotine from overseas companies and importing them into the country for personal use.
